THE GLIMMERS OF EMPOWERMENT WOMEN AND LAND RIGHTS

Using feminist lenses, we bring you the lived realities of African women in Southern Africa regarding access to, control and ownership of land. Across the world, many women tell similar tales of discrimination, underpinned by cultural norms that deny women rights to land and the risks involved in seeking to secure land rights. This collection of oral herstories showcases acts of courage in the face of these obstacles, chronicling the lives of women who have dared to challenge discrimination, applied the law to protest land injustice and engaged with power holders to shift unequal power relations.
